| Episode | Title | Runtime (approx) | Notes | |---------|-------|----------------|-------| | 1 | It’s About Time | 48 min | Extended premiere; establishes world & Omni-Man’s betrayal tease | | 2 | Here Goes Nothing | 44 min | Includes the Flaxan dimension fight | | 3 | Who You Calling Ugly? | 43 min | Focus on Titan, Machine Head, and Battle Beast intro | | 4 | Neil Armstrong, Eat Your Heart Out | 44 min | Mars subplot + Omni-Man’s growing instability | | 5 | That Actually Hurt | 44 min | Reanimen & Omni-Man’s public rage | | 6 | You Look Kinda Dead | 52 min | – Nolan’s backstory & the “I’d still have you” scene | | 7 | We Need to Talk | 46 min | Emotional confrontation between Mark & Debbie | | 8 | Where I Really Come From | 54 min | Season finale – Omni-Man vs. Mark (extended fight, ~15 min of pure violence) | invincible episode length

For decades, there has been a frustrating double standard in entertainment. Live-action dramas like Succession or Breaking Bad are granted extended runtimes to explore complex character dynamics.
